"Netting" is a word in ENGLISH
The act or process of making nets or network, or of
forming meshes, as for fancywork, fishing nets, etc.
A network of ropes used for various purposes, as for
holding the hammocks when not in use, also for stowing sails, and for
hoisting from the gunwale to the rigging to hinder an enemy from
boarding.
A piece of network; any fabric, made of cords, threads,
wires, or the like, crossing one another with open spaces between.
